Welcome! 

Register :: Login
Image
Manufactured By:
Loshbough-Jordan Tool & Machine Co.
Elkhart, IN

Image Detail
Details
Title: 1922 Ad - L-J Inclinable Fly Wheel Press
Source: "The Iron Age." Vol. 110, No. 4, Jul. 27, 1922. Pg. 160.
Insert Date: 7/3/2019 9:39:45 PM

Image Description:
Image
Image 1
Direct Link
IMG Code